Powering the Beast—Literally
What most people don’t understand is that running 1 million GPUs requires more than just money and ambition. It requires energy—lots of it.
So Musk is doing what only Musk can do: building his own power infrastructure.
Just outside Memphis, XAI is constructing the largest Tesla Megapack site in the U.S., housing over 900 units capable of storing 3,600 megawatt hours of energy—enough to power 1 million GPUs for at least four hours at peak demand.
That’s not just a backup plan. That’s a custom-built energy grid for the age of intelligence.
And in a stroke of genius, this massive site won’t just serve AI—it will stabilize the local power grid for thousands of Memphis residents, further entrenching Musk’s technology into the American energy landscape.
